CCSA coaches are all volunteer coaches. CCSA does not require its recreational coaches to be licensed for coaching. CCSA does encourage coaches to attend trainings when available to stay up to date on new drills, technical skill teaching and safety issues.


Each team must have at least one Coach and one Assistant Coach.  Central Coast Soccer Association requires every coach to complete a Background Disclosure Statements (part of the registration packet completed online.)
